I don't think there's a compatibility issue here though. The current kernel doesn't care if the property is longer than 1 base+size. It only checks if the size is less than 1 base+size. And yes, we can rely on that implementation detail. It's only an ABI if an existing user notices. Now, if the low memory is listed first, then an older kdump kernel would get a different memory range. If that's a problem, then define that low memory goes last. Rob
